RCW 36.70.230Board of adjustment—Terms.If the board of adjustment is to consist of three members, when it is first appointed after June 10, 1959, the first terms shall be as follows: One shall be appointed for one year; one, for two years; and one, for three years. If it consists of five members, when it is first appointed after June 10, 1959, the first terms shall be as follows: One shall be appointed for one year; one, for two years; one, for three years; one, for four years; and one, for six years. Thereafter the terms shall be for six years and until their successors are appointed and qualified.[ 1963 c 4 s 36.70.230. Prior: 1959 c 201 s 23.]
